<b>Act 1.(12')</b>
- Use a card with letter Jj (or write on board the letter Jj)
to introduce to the students the new lesson.
- Instruct students how to pronounce the letter name and
the letter sound by saying: “This is the letter J /d<i>ʒeɪ</i>/The
letter J says /d<i>ʒ</i>/.”
- Repeat several times and check students’ pronunciation
(letter J/ d<i>ʒeɪ</i>/ and its sound /d<i>ʒ</i>/)
- Use the phonics cards with jam, jelly and juice, read
the words out loud and have students repeat.
<b>1. Listen, point and </b>
<b>repeat. Colour</b>
- Place the phonics cards from the previous lesson on the teacher’s desk
- Have a student come to the desk
- Use gestures (hand actions) to help students to
understand the meanings of the three words.
Jam: imitate eating jam
Jelly: hold a plate of jelly that jiggle
- Stick the cards on board and have students repeat the
words chorally several times (in the correct order and
then in any order).
- Call some students to say the words out loud and
correct their mistakes (if any)
